LTC6955IUKG#TRPBF Overview
As a clock IC, PLLs is packaged using the Tape & Reel (TR) method. As part of the 52-WFQFN Exposed Pad package, this clock generator is embedded. This Clock PLL will be fed by Differential as its input. To access the electronic component's full performance, 1 circuits are implemented. A clock-based RF synthesizer that provides a max frequency of 7.5GHz is available. A Surface Mount-shaped electrical component makes it convenient to mount on a panel. This clock PLL works with a supply voltage of 3.15V~3.45V. Using the test statistics, we estimate that the ambient temperature should be -40°C~125°C. This is a clock generator compatible with CML logic levels. It is possible to classify this electronic component as a Fanout Buffer (Distribution).
